Mercedes and Red Bull share practice spoils in Abu Dhabi
Valtteri Bottas pic: Mercedes Twitter Valtteri Bottas and Max Verstappen shared the spoils following the opening day's running ahead of the Formula 1 Abu Dhabi Grand Prix. The Finn topped the second session for Mercedes following on from a Red Bull 1-2 in the opening practice session. Bottas headed the timesheets early in Practice 2 only for Kimi Raikkonen to better the Mercedes driver's time inside the opening half our. He was relegated further back by Sebastian Vettel in the sister Ferrari to Raikkonen before reclaiming top spot with a 1:37.236s lap.
